Leighton, Clare

Leighton, Clare lāˈtən [key], 1899–1989, English print maker, writer, and illustrator. Leighton was best known for her fine woodcuts and engravings and her work is represented in leading print collections in England and America. She illustrated works by Hardy and the Brontës.
